Epson XP-235 Printer & Multipack Ink CartridgesThe Epson XP-235 printer is an all-in-one color inkjet printer. This printer is a budget printer and is ideal for students and home users. It consumes Epson XP-235 printer ink cartridges multipack. On purchase of the printer, you will get a set of installer cartridges with the package.

The Epson XP-235 all-in-one printer weighs 4.1 kgs. The width, depth and height of this printer are 390mm, 300 mm and 145 mm respectively. The printer is easy to handle.

The Epson XP-235 printer is known for its smart and neat design. It has a Contact Image Sensor flatbed scanner, commonly known as CIS scanner. It has a control panel of LED light indicators with two indicators for the wireless link. Along with the wireless printing option, the printer also has a USB cable slot situated at the back. The printer is programmed to work on OS X and WIndows both.

The Epson XP-235 printer offers a speed of 7.7 ppm for black and white printouts and 1.1 ppm for a color graphic printout. The print speed for a photo is however slightly slow. The printer offers good print quality. You can purchase the Epson XP-235 Ink Cartridges online once the installer cartridges are over. It offers a print head resolution of 5760 dpi and a scan resolution of 1200 X 2400 ppi. The maximum paper size that can be fed to the printer is A4.

What are the steps to be followed if the print quality of Epson XP-235 is poor?

Epson XP-335 opened.jpgOne might face some issues like blurry prints, banding, missing colours of the printouts etc, when the Epson Expression series printer has blocked printhead nozzles or because of the dried out Epson Expression XP-235 ink cartridges. Whichever the cause is, the print quality issue can be resolved by following some easy steps.

  • Use paper supported by this printer
  • Select the appropriate paper type setting for the type of paper loaded in the printer
  • Avoid using damp, old, or damaged paper
  • Flatten the paper or envelope before using them
  • Use higher quality setting before printing
  • Check if you are using compatible Epson XP-235 ink cartridges that are designed to work best with the printer
  • Let the printouts dry completely before filling them or displaying them. Do not allow direct contact with the sunlight or use a dryer to dry the printouts
  • Use high-resolution data while printing images or photos as the images on websites are often in low resolution although they look good enough on the display
Conserving Black ink when it is low (for Windows only)

When black ink is running low and there is enough colour Epson XP-235 ink cartridges remaining then you can use a mixture of colour inks to create the black ink so that you can continue printing while you order a replacement. In the printer driver select the following settings:

  • Select Paper Type: plain papers
  • Quality: Standard
  • Now Epson Status Monitor 3: enabled

In case the Epson Status Monitor 3 is disabled access the printer driver, click extended settings on the maintenance tab and then enable Epson Status Monitor 3. The composite black ink is slightly different than the black ink and the printing speed is slowed down.

The Epson Status Monitor 3 displays three options:
  • Yes: Select when you want to use the mixture of colour inks to create black ink
  • No: Select if you want to continue using remaining black ink
  • Disable this feature; Select this to continue using black ink. This window is not displayed until you replace the black ink cartridge & it runs low again.

Q. My Epson XP-235 printer is producing smeared printouts. Is there any solution to this problem?
A. You can follow and try these solutions for this problem:

  1. You need to ensure that you are using the correct printer driver.
  2. Use only paper that is suggested by Epson.
  3. Keep the printer on a flat surface. It will not operate if it is tilted.
  4. Make sure that the paper you are using is not dirty, damaged or too old.
  5. The printable size of the paper should face upwards in the sheet feeder.
  6. Curl it slightly on the opposite side, if the paper is curled towards the printable side.
  7. If you are printing on glossy media or transparencies, then you would need to place a support sheet (or a sheet of plain paper) below the stack. Or you should load only one sheet at a time.
  8. Clean the printhead.

Even after repeatedly cleaning and aligning the print head, if the quality of your printouts remains the same, this may be because one or some of the carriages are old or damaged and need replacement.

Q. Why do I get an inverted image every time I try to print one on this printer?
A. You will have to check for the mirror image settings in the printer driver. If the mirror image option is active follow the steps given:

  1. For Windows - Go to ‘more options’ in the printer driver tab and click on ‘clear mirror image’.
  2. For Mac OS - Go to ‘print settings’ in the printer driver's tab and click on ‘clear mirror image’.
  3. Further, if this doesn't work out, remove the printer driver and install it again. This should solve your problem.
